From Publishers Weekly

Bolen, a psychiatrist and professor at the University of California Medical School, believes that women need to stand up for their rights, wants and desires and can't afford to be complainers or whiners. Explains Bolen, the author of The Millionth Circle and Goddesses in Older Women, "To be involved and engaged in life is a juicy proposition. Every juicy crone taps into a wellspring or a deep aquifer of meaning in her psyche." They are, according to Bolen, smart, compassionate, courageous and humorous. In these brief essays, she offers commonsense wisdom, calling on women to empower themselves, but also to fight against any emotional demons or problems they have. For example, in discussing women who have been abused or otherwise have some secret from their past that they're ashamed of, she writes, "At some point in their lives, most remember fearing that this truth would become known. Crones, however, also recall when and with whom they broke this taboo of silence as the beginning of feeling whole. To speak the truth is to be able to say, this is who I am." Fans of Bolen's quirky, spiritual tone will find these words comforting. However, much of the text discusses why women need to be juicy crones without offering much practical advice to improve one's life. Copyright 2003 Reed Business Information, Inc.

Review

"Women over 50 are a country to which this youth-obsessed culture has few guides. Whether we're living there now or hope to be, Jean Shinoda Bolen gives us sign-posts to this land of wisdom, joy, freedom, and leadership." --Gloria Steinem"A wise and honest book. Profoundly important to the sustainability of our species and world." --Alice Walker"This is a lighthearted manual on how to become a juicy and wise old woman. I certainly want to be one of those crones who doesn't whine!" --Isabel Allende"Her humor so available, her wisdom so needed--speaking as a crone, that is!" --Olympia Dukakis

Yeah, sure the cosmetics industry and plastic surgery doctors promise maturing women with returned nubile faces, plumped lips and smoother neck, but they sure can't give us the self-acceptance and self-love that Jean, in this book, helps us discover---new meaning for our post 50s years. This book opened my eyes and my heart to what my life can be like in my maturing years and helped me look forward to that time, envision it and be excited about it. Will any glossy-covered fashion magazine will offer this kind of information to their readers if it competes with their advertisers! The book is short-ish and easy to read, but its enough to comfort me and get me excited about who I am still growing to be. Dr. Bolen's book Crones Don't Whine is the basis for two weekly discussion groups in Royal Oaks, a continuing care community in Sun City, AZ. The women in the groups are enjoying and growing by reading and discussing this well-written book. Its short, thought-provoking chapters are stimulating and elicit deep discussions in the group and thoughtful reflections in our journals. I highly recommend this book to any woman who would have a deeper understanding of what the Crone stage of life can be.

I have found wisdom and guidance in Jean Shinolda Bolen's books since I read "Crossing to Avalon" many years ago. This book is short and pithy. Very short and very pithy. It is, in fact, concentrated...like sun-dried tomato paste or pomegranate syrup. My own desire would have been for more depth and development, but its advantage as it stands is in an almost haiku quality. I read it, one chapter a night, for several nights and reading it that way makes it a form of meditation. I suspect it would be a delightful gift from one woman in the crone years to a younger one just entering that stage of existence. If you are looking for honesty, humor and challenge, this is your book. However, if this is the first Bolen book you read, don't stop here! Pick up one of her others: "Goddesses for Older Women," "Crossing to Avalon," "Goddesses for Everywoman," and delve even deeper into her ideas.

I LOVE this author's books. My one small criticism of this book - it doesn't provide enough "instruction" for me. I appreciate that the author states WHAT a crone is and isn't - but I'd like more detail on HOW to accomplish the things she describes. Overall it's a fairly short and easy read - worthwhile.
